      I went to the Bulldawg Musclecars' monthly meet and greet last Saturday morning and was able to take a few progress shot of the car. After hunting some parts down and getting a couple more good guys added to Joe's team, they have been able to make some good headway over the last couple of weeks. They have not started setting the gaps for the front end yet, but Joe said that was the next step and that they will be starting that step this week. Anyway, here are some pics of what the car looked like on Saturday.

      Front end hung to check fitment with new doors.


      Reinforcing braces welded onto subframe.



      Pretty new hood hinges.


      Shaved drip rail (in progress).


      Beginnings of modified front valance.


      Modified cowl.


      I am so happy to it resembling a real car again. Even seeing it in this shape made me remember how much I love the lines of the '67-'68 Camaros. Thanks to Joe, Jeremy, Curt, Ben and Eric for all your hard work. I can't wait to see the progress next!
